Respondents/Complainant PRAYER: Criminal Original Petition filed under Section 482 of Cr.P.C, praying to direct the Special Judge for SC/ST (Prevention of Atrocities) Act/3rd Additional District and Sessions judge(PCR Unit) Madurai to consider the bail application of the petitioner on the same day of his surrender in Cr.No.1555 of 2020 on the file of the respondent police For Petitioner : Mr.R.Manoharan For Respondents : Mr.R.M.Anbunithi No.1 and 2 Additional Public Prosecutor

O R D E R

This petition is filed for a direction to direct the learned Special Judge for SC/ST (Prevention of Atrocities) Act/3rd Additional District and Sessions judge(PCR Unit) Madurai to consider the bail application of the petitioner on the same day of his surrender in Cr.No.1555 of 2020 on the file of the respondent police.

2. In view of the specific bar under Section 18 of the Scheduled Castes and Scheduled Tribes (Prevention of Atrocities) Act, 1989 and also taking into consideration the possibility of misusing the pious intention of the Parliament against innocent persons, there shall be a direction to the learned Special Judge for SC/ST (Prevention of Atrocities) Act/3rd Additional District and Sessions judge(PCR Unit) Madurai, to consider the petitioner's bail application, preferably on the same day of his surrender in connection with Crime No. 1555 of 2020 on the file of the 2nd respondent and pass appropriate orders in accordance with law after https://hcservices.ecourts.gov.in/hcservices/ 1/2

Crl.O.P.(MD) No.4206 of 2022 affording due opportunity to the victim under Section 15(a) of the SC/ST Act. The petitioner shall surrender before the concerned jurisdictional Court within a period of fifteen days from the date of the receipt of a copy of this Order.

3. In view of the above, the Criminal Original Petition stands allowed.
